Mission Contribution

To ensure the efficient and cost effective operation and stewardship of the Goodwill retail store to maximize profitability and increase employment and/or training opportunities.

Function

Under the team leadership of the Director of Store Development or the Store Manager, the Assistant Manager is responsible for all aspects of operating a donated goods retail store.

Essential Functions
  • Ensures World Class donor and customer service.
  • Trains, develops, supervises and evaluates team members within the framework of Goodwill policies and procedures and job descriptions.
  • Must be able to conduct hands-on training and be proficient and meet the physical requirements in the performance of every store job. Must be a hands-on leader, personally involved in every area of the operation of the store.
  • Operates the retail store within budgeted expense to revenue ratios and donor value. Meets daily sales and processing goals.
  • Responsible for good stewardship of all donations, through proper handling and processing of incoming donation flow in and out of the retail store in accordance with Agency policies and procedures.
  • Personally checks the WESA reports, and register journals. Routinely audits register tills during business hours. Ensures there are individual cash drawers for all cashiers and that cash is counted before a cashier’s shift begins and after the shift ends.
  • Manages payroll to meet sales and profit goals. Responsible for the review, audit and approval of time sheets.
  • Responsible for securing assistance and/or manpower to meet the maintenance needs of the store.
  • Responsible for the security and safety of the store. Reports all accidents and injuries of team members, trainees, and customers and reports any safety, security, unusual incidents or loss prevention issues to the Risk Management Department immediately.
  • Responsible for ordering and maintaining supplies and all other agency property in a secured manner in accordance with established budget and Agency practices.
  • Ensure the following statistical counts are completed in an accurate and timely manner:
    Donor counts and Bank deposits;
    Cash counts and Apparel hang counts;
    Rotation counts;
    Salvage.
  • Works with the Director of Risk Management to maintain compliance with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facility standards.
  • Keeps abreast of product knowledge, industry trends, and competitive pricing through comparative shopping of competitors (e.g. full or discount retail, consignment, and second-hand thrift).
  • Ensures the goods are sized, colorized, barcoded, tagged, and on the proper color/date rotation at all times. Ensures rotation and markdowns are taken according to guiding principles.
  • Performs assigned duties and management responsibilities within the framework of our Mission, Vision, Core Values and Guiding Principles.
  • Attends in-service and related training as assigned by Store Manager, Director or VP.
  • May be asked to participate in activities and events that promote and/or generate revenue for the agency.
  • Performs other duties as assigned by Store Manager.
